#d1b5f0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d1b5f0 is composed of 82% red, 71%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.9% cyan, 24.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 268.5 degrees, a saturation of 66.3% and a lightness of 82.5%. #d1b5f0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a36be1.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

#d1b5f0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d1b5f0 has RGB values of R:209, G:181, B:240 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0.25,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 13743600.
